#b4ef38 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b4ef38 is composed of 70.6% red, 93.7% green and 22%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 24.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 76.6% yellow and 6.3% black. It has a hue angle of 79.3 degrees, a saturation of 85.1% and a lightness of 57.8%. #b4ef38 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ff70 with #69df00. Closest websafe color is: #ccff33.

#b4ef38 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b4ef38 has RGB values of R:180, G:239, B:56 and CMYK values of C:0.25, M:0, Y:0.77,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 11857720.
